Stupid was a short-lived grouping of constructivist artists, formed in Cologne in 1919. The founding members were Anton Räderscheidt, Heinrich Hoerle, and Franz Wilhelm Seiwert.

Seiwert and Räderscheidt were at the time active in the local Dada scene. Räderscheidt's studio was their base of operations, but by 1920 he had abandoned the constructivist style. The group exhibited together and issued a publication, "Stupid 1", before disbanding.
